While Bamford Train Station is quaint and offers a welcoming atmosphere, it has limited facilities. There is no ticket office, but passengers can collect their tickets from the available ticket machines. However, users of smartcards will need to validate them elsewhere, as the station lacks validators. For those who prefer digital browsing to enrich their journeys, public Wi-Fi is available, making it easy to stay connected or plan your day out in the Peak District.
Accessibility might be a concern for some, as the station provides step-free access only to the Manchester platform, with steps leading down to the Sheffield platform. There are no accessible toilets or waiting rooms, but customers will find seating areas available. Although staff assistance isn't directly available, customers can use the help points for any inquiries or request assistance with the help of conductors present on trains.
Getting to and from Bamford Station is a breeze with several local transport options. For bus travel, information can be printed out via the National Rail website, making it simple to plan your onward journey. If you need a taxi, services can be arranged through Northern Railway’s Cab4You, ensuring a smooth transition from rail to road.
While traditional bicycle hire is not available directly at the station, cycling enthusiasts will be pleased to find 16 bicycle storage spaces. This is a hearty addition, considering the region's popularity among cyclists exploring the trails and rolling landscapes.

Located on the East Coast Main Line and managed by Great Northern, this suburban station offers a gateway to city life and beyond.
Oakleigh Park station ensures that ticketing is a breeze, with a ticket office operational from Monday to Saturday. For those who prefer swift transactions, ticket machines accommodate both online ticket collections and those with a Disabled Persons Railcard. Additionally, the station upholds accessibility with an induction loop and ticket machines that are accessible in design, although the lack of step-free access might be something to plan around.
While the station doesn't provide waiting rooms or toilets, it does offer essential customer support through help points and staffed assistance during morning hours on weekdays and Saturdays. For comfort, there's seating available for those awaiting their trains, and for a quick bite or some shopping, the station offers refreshment facilities as well as shops, though there's no ATM or currency exchange available. Cyclists among you will find eight bicycle storage spaces right next to the station entrance, albeit without shelter or CCTV security.
Oakleigh Park station is well-connected with other modes of transport, ensuring your onward journey is seamless. Whether you need to hop on a bus or prefer a taxi, options are readily available. The taxi office is conveniently situated at the entrance to platform 1, making it easy for you to catch a quick ride.
